Transaction 35aae53bb3c742002a110f624a9c1b57aa85ee952f4461881fe9b13e83f55758
1 Input
2 Outputs
- 35aae53bb3c742002a110f624a9c1b57aa85ee952f4461881fe9b13e83f55758:0
- 35aae53bb3c742002a110f624a9c1b57aa85ee952f4461881fe9b13e83f55758:1
value 1413259
address 32WkPQmFSnkMxz24xvr1qAGBVvRJrwwVnF
value 2018816
address 1CCHh5d96AehdK2R57pvxkk4F2hbnG2hcG